Determine the methods and sequences of manufacturing operations for simple to moderately complex products.
Essential Job Functions:
It is required for this position to determine the methods and sequences of manufacturing operations for simple to moderately complex products. Responsible for creating work instructions and supporting procedures. You will be responsible for the design, development, and implementation of tooling to support the transition to manufacturing. Must be able to identify and resolve issues affecting completion of a manufacturing project. Provide technical support to production and Quality Assurance to improve productivity and reduce costs. Must be capable of notifying and working successfully with others to resolve issues affecting timely completion of a manufacturing project. Create engineering changes in response to ECR's.
Education and Certifications:
B.S. Engineering with (2) years of relevant experience in mechanical or electrical engineering.
